- The distance between Harrisburg, Il, Usa and Heraklion, Crete, Greece is approximately 9,416 km or 5,851 mi.
- To reach Harrisburg, Il in this distance one would set out from Heraklion, Crete bearing 313.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Harrisburg, Il bearing 228.4° or SW .
- Harrisburg, Il has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Heraklion, Crete has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Both are in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 4.8 °C (8.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12 °C (21.6°F) more in Harrisburg, Il.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 654.6 mm (25.8 in) more which is equivalent to 654.6 l/m² (16.07 US gal/ft²) or 6,546,000 l/ha (699,811 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.7° lower in Harrisburg, Il than in Heraklion, Crete.
